Kell Brook explains how he’d beat Floyd Mayweather

Kell Brook outlines how he'd overcome pound-for-pound king Floyd Mayweather

John Dennen

26th January, 2015

Kell Brook explains how he’d beat Floyd Mayweather
Boxing - Boxing News Feature - Meadowhall Shopping Centre, Sheffield - 14/1/15

“I’D like to take Floyd Mayweather off his throne,” IBF welterweight world champion Kell Brook told Boxing News. “I’m very confident, he’s not 25 anymore… he’s not 35 anymore! It’s a young man’s game. Someone who’s hungry, passionate, fit and has the desire to take the pound-for-pound king out, it’s gonna be a big thing. I’m very accurate and powerful and he hasn’t been in with someone for a long time who’s young and big and strong at the weight, unbeaten and who feels they can’t lose. He’s always picked his fights and they haven’t matched up. Saul Alvarez waits a little bit, with me I’d be putting that pressure on and I’ll be trying to imitate what he does and people underestimate my speed. We’d come up with the perfect game plan.”
